‘RHONJ’: Caroline Manzo’s husband Albert accused of cheating

See also

October 3, 2013

Real Housewives of New Jersey" star Caroline Manzo’s husband, Albert Manzo, is being accused of cheating on his wife, Radar Online reported on Oct. 2.

“During filming of the fifth season, Caroline realized her marriage wasn’t picture perfect,” said one source.
Caroline Manzo has been married to Albert Manzo for 29 years, and has recently decided to quit “The Real Housewives of New Jersey,” and focus on her spin-off show, in which her marital troubles could prove to be a big storyline.

“Tensions started to rise between Caroline and Al over his work schedule. She thought it was important for Al to take time off from work to spend more time with the family. It really frustrated Caroline that Al refused to listen to her. He would continuously put work before their relationship and his family.”

It was Penny Drossos who first revealed the rumors that Caroline’s husband may be unfaithful, but Manzo is reportedly standing by her man.

“He’s a good man,” the “RHONJ” star said. “If we didn’t have the relationship that we have, it would be different. I would go to hell and back for him, and he would do the same. So of course it’s worth the fight,” she added.
